<?php
use PHPUnit\Framework\Assert;
/**
* Localization completeness tests.
*
* Spanish is the reference locale and is strictly enforced: any English
* string without a Spanish translation fails the suite, preventing
* untranslated content from reaching production.
*
* French is an optional, community-maintained locale. Its gaps only emit a
* warning — an incomplete French translation never blocks CI, but the run
* still surfaces exactly which keys are missing so they can be filled in.
*/
/**
* Locales whose translation gaps must fail the suite.
*
* @var array<string>
*/
const ENFORCED_LOCALES = ['es'];
/**
* Locales whose translation gaps only emit a warning.
*
* @var array<string>
*/
const OPTIONAL_LOCALES = ['fr'];
/**
* Recursively flattens a nested PHP translation array using dot notation.
*
* @param array<string, mixed> $array
* @param array<string, string> $result
* @return array<string, string>
*/
function flattenTranslations(array $array, string $prefix = '', array $result = []): array
{
foreach ($array as $key => $value) {
$fullKey = $prefix !== '' ? "{$prefix}.{$key}" : (string) $key;
if (is_array($value)) {
$result = flattenTranslations($value, $fullKey, $result);
} else {
$result[$fullKey] = (string) $value;
}
}
return $result;
}
/**
* Extracts all static string keys passed to the __() i18n function from
* TypeScript/TSX source files. Only literal string arguments are captured;
* dynamic expressions are intentionally skipped.
*
* @return array<string>
*/
function extractI18nKeysFromSource(): array
{
$resourcesPath = base_path('resources/js');
$keys = [];
$iterator = new RecursiveIteratorIterator(
new RecursiveDirectoryIterator($resourcesPath, FilesystemIterator::SKIP_DOTS)
);
/** @var SplFileInfo $file */
foreach ($iterator as $file) {
if (! in_array($file->getExtension(), ['ts', 'tsx'], strict: true)) {
continue;
}
$content = file_get_contents($file->getPathname());
if ($content === false) {
continue;
}
// Match __('single-quoted key') and __("double-quoted key")
// Skips template literals and variable references by design.
preg_match_all("/__\(\s*'([^'\\\\]*(?:\\\\.[^'\\\\]*)*)'\s*[,)]/", $content, $singleQuoted);
preg_match_all('/__\(\s*"([^"\\\\]*(?:\\\\.[^"\\\\]*)*)"\s*[,)]/', $content, $doubleQuoted);
$keys = array_merge($keys, $singleQuoted[1], $doubleQuoted[1]);
}
return array_unique($keys);
}
/**
* Computes the PHP translation keys present in lang/en but missing from the
* given locale, grouped by filename. A wholly absent file is reported as the
* sentinel "__missing_file__".
*
* @return array<string, array<string>>
*/
function missingPhpTranslationKeys(string $locale): array
{
$englishDir = lang_path('en');
$missingByFile = [];
/** @var SplFileInfo $file */
foreach (new FilesystemIterator($englishDir, FilesystemIterator::SKIP_DOTS) as $file) {
if ($file->getExtension() !== 'php') {
continue;
}
$filename = $file->getFilename();
$localePath = lang_path("{$locale}/{$filename}");
if (! file_exists($localePath)) {
$missingByFile[$filename] = ['__missing_file__'];
continue;
}
$englishKeys = flattenTranslations(require $file->getPathname());
$localeKeys = flattenTranslations(require $localePath);
$missingKeys = array_keys(array_diff_key($englishKeys, $localeKeys));
if ($missingKeys !== []) {
$missingByFile[$filename] = $missingKeys;
}
}
return $missingByFile;
}
/**
* Renders a human-readable report of missing PHP translation keys.
*
* @param array<string, array<string>> $missingByFile
*/
function formatPhpTranslationReport(string $locale, array $missingByFile): string
{
return implode("\n", array_map(
fn (string $f, array $keys) => "lang/{$locale}/{$f}:\n - ".implode("\n - ", $keys),
array_keys($missingByFile),
$missingByFile,
));
}
/**
* Computes the __() source keys missing from the given locale's JSON file.
* A missing or malformed file is reported via a sentinel entry.
*
* @return array<string>
*/
function missingJsonTranslationKeys(string $locale): array
{
$jsonPath = lang_path("{$locale}.json");
if (! file_exists($jsonPath)) {
return ['__missing_file__'];
}
$json = json_decode(file_get_contents($jsonPath), associative: true);
if (! is_array($json)) {
return ['__invalid_json__'];
}
$sourceKeys = extractI18nKeysFromSource();
$missingKeys = array_values(array_filter(
$sourceKeys,
fn (string $key) => ! array_key_exists($key, $json)
));
sort($missingKeys);
return $missingKeys;
}
describe('enforced PHP translations', function () {
it('has every English PHP key translated', function (string $locale) {
$missingByFile = missingPhpTranslationKeys($locale);
expect($missingByFile)->toBeEmpty(
"{$locale} PHP translation files have missing keys:\n".formatPhpTranslationReport($locale, $missingByFile)
);
})->with(ENFORCED_LOCALES);
});
describe('enforced JSON translations', function () {
it('has every __() source key translated', function (string $locale) {
expect(lang_path("{$locale}.json"))->toBeFile("Missing lang/{$locale}.json translation file");
$missingKeys = missingJsonTranslationKeys($locale);
expect($missingKeys)->toBeEmpty(
count($missingKeys)." key(s) used in source via __() are missing from lang/{$locale}.json:\n - ".implode("\n - ", $missingKeys)
);
})->with(ENFORCED_LOCALES);
});
describe('optional PHP translations', function () {
it('warns about untranslated PHP keys', function (string $locale) {
$missingByFile = missingPhpTranslationKeys($locale);
if ($missingByFile !== []) {
// Optional locale: surface the gap as an incomplete test so it stays
// visible in the run summary without failing CI (no failOnIncomplete
// is configured).
Assert::markTestIncomplete(
"Optional locale '{$locale}' has missing PHP translation keys (not blocking):\n"
.formatPhpTranslationReport($locale, $missingByFile)
);
}
expect($missingByFile)->toBeEmpty();
})->with(OPTIONAL_LOCALES);
});
describe('optional JSON translations', function () {
it('warns about __() source keys missing from the locale JSON', function (string $locale) {
$missingKeys = missingJsonTranslationKeys($locale);
if ($missingKeys !== []) {
// Optional locale: surface the gap as an incomplete test so it stays
// visible in the run summary without failing CI (no failOnIncomplete
// is configured).
Assert::markTestIncomplete(
count($missingKeys)." key(s) used in source via __() are missing from lang/{$locale}.json (not blocking):\n - "
.implode("\n - ", $missingKeys)
);
}
expect($missingKeys)->toBeEmpty();
})->with(OPTIONAL_LOCALES);
});
